I've done lots of re-enforcement like this on TJ and JKU Skids (My Wife is particularly good at bending stuff in her JKU).

Found the best thing to be 1/4" inch thick 2 inch Angle iron laid with the point up, then welded along both edges in about 4 inch stretches with a 2 inch weld between stretches...

I don't have an example in the shop right now or I'd take a picture for you...

Annual Memorial day trip report, didn't make the final destination due to multiple down trees. Ended up dispersion camping half way.

Nice 80F high during the first day, lots of mosquitoes and cold 40F low. Next day was a wonderful 70F but got windy towards the evening. By 6pm I was adding tie down ropes to the tent and packing up for a storm. Brutal night of wind and some occasional snow/hail. Very ruff night, portable heater ran on high to keep the inside of the tent warm enough for the dogs.
